What Are GRP Cabinets?
GRP cupboards are safety units made using Glass Reinforced Plastic, additionally called fiberglass enhanced polymer (FRP). The product integrates strong glass fibers with resilient polymer resin, resulting in a light-weight yet very durable compound. GRP Cabinets
Unlike standard steel or light weight aluminum cabinets, GRP closets do not corrosion, rust, or wear away when subjected to dampness, salt, ultraviolet (UV) radiation, or numerous commercial chemicals. This one-of-a-kind mix of toughness and toughness has made them a favored option across numerous industries.

Why Industries Are Changing to GRP Cabinets
1. Impressive Deterioration Resistance
One of the greatest challenges with steel cabinets is rust. In seaside regions, industrial plants, wastewater centers, and chemical processing atmospheres, steel rooms typically call for frequent maintenance or substitute as a result of rust.
GRP cabinets naturally resist corrosion without calling for safety finishings or normal repainting. This significantly extends their life span while decreasing maintenance expenditures.
2. Superb Weather Defense
Outside equipment is frequently revealed to rainfall, sunlight, moisture, dirt, and varying temperatures.
Top notch GRP cupboards are specifically made to endure:
Heavy rainfall
Severe warmth
Freezing temperature levels
UV exposure
High moisture
Salt-laden coastal air
Their weather-resistant building helps preserve the integrity of delicate electrical and digital tools over many years.
3. Light-weight Yet Very Solid
Although considerably lighter than steel cupboards, GRP provides remarkable architectural strength.
The lighter weight provides several sensible advantages:
Much easier transport
Faster installation
Decreased labor costs
Lower structural loading
Streamlined maintenance
This makes GRP cabinets specifically important for remote installations where transportation can be challenging.
4. Electrical Insulation
Unlike metal rooms, GRP is normally non-conductive.
This particular decreases electric threats and improves security for professionals executing upkeep or inspections. It additionally minimizes dangers related to unintentional electrical contact.
5. Reduced Maintenance Needs
Upkeep costs can end up being substantial over the life-span of commercial tools.
Considering that GRP cupboards withstand deterioration, fading, and environmental destruction, they generally call for just periodic cleaning and examination as opposed to extensive repair work or painting.
This contributes to a reduced total price of possession over the closet’s operational life.

Secret Attributes to Take Into Consideration When Picking GRP Cabinets
Not all GRP cabinets are manufactured to the same standards.
When selecting the best enclosure, take into consideration the following elements:
Access Security (IP) Score
A higher IP ranking gives higher security against dirt and water. Outside installations typically need IP65 or greater depending on ecological conditions.
Mechanical Strength
Make sure the cabinet can hold up against physical effects, specifically in public or commercial locations.
UV Stability
Outside installments gain from UV-stabilized products that prevent fading and architectural deterioration in time.
Fire Resistance
Certain applications require flame-retardant materials that follow relevant fire safety and security requirements.
Dimension and Configuration
Select closet measurements that permit enough room for existing devices while fitting future expansion.
Securing Devices
Safe and secure securing systems help safeguard beneficial tools from unapproved accessibility and criminal damage.
